Skip to content

Commit 8926618

Browse files
authored
Migrate from EE 8 to EE 9 (#1124)
1 parent 6aefb45 commit 8926618

File tree

5 files changed

+15
-15
lines changed

5 files changed

+15
-15
lines changed

pom.xml

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44
<parent>
55
<groupId>org.jenkins-ci.plugins</groupId>
66
<artifactId>plugin</artifactId>
7-
<version>4.88</version>
7+
<version>5.5</version>
88
<relativePath />
99
</parent>
1010

@@ -62,8 +62,8 @@
6262
<properties>
6363
<revision>1.7.1</revision>
6464
<changelist>-SNAPSHOT</changelist>
65-
<jenkins.baseline>2.452</jenkins.baseline>
66-
<jenkins.version>${jenkins.baseline}.4</jenkins.version>
65+
<jenkins.baseline>2.479</jenkins.baseline>
66+
<jenkins.version>${jenkins.baseline}.1</jenkins.version>
6767
<gitHubRepo>jenkinsci/docker-plugin</gitHubRepo>
6868
<!-- Our unit-tests that talk to a real docker deamon aren't very stable -->
6969
<surefire.rerunFailingTestsCount>3</surefire.rerunFailingTestsCount>

src/main/java/com/nirima/jenkins/plugins/docker/DockerManagementServer.java

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-13,8 +13,8 @@
1313
import java.util.Date;
1414
import jenkins.model.Jenkins;
1515
import org.kohsuke.stapler.QueryParameter;
16-
import org.kohsuke.stapler.StaplerRequest;
17-
import org.kohsuke.stapler.StaplerResponse;
16+
import org.kohsuke.stapler.StaplerRequest2;
17+
import org.kohsuke.stapler.StaplerResponse2;
1818
import org.kohsuke.stapler.interceptor.RequirePOST;
1919

2020
/**
@@ -73,7 +73,7 @@ public String asTime(Long time) {
7373

7474
@SuppressWarnings("unused")
7575
@RequirePOST
76-
public void doControlSubmit(@QueryParameter("stopId") String stopId, StaplerRequest req, StaplerResponse rsp)
76+
public void doControlSubmit(@QueryParameter("stopId") String stopId, StaplerRequest2 req, StaplerResponse2 rsp)
7777
throws IOException {
7878
Jenkins.get().checkPermission(Jenkins.ADMINISTER);
7979
final DockerAPI dockerApi = theCloud.getDockerApi();

src/main/java/com/nirima/jenkins/plugins/docker/DockerPluginConfiguration.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44
import java.util.List;
55
import jenkins.model.GlobalConfiguration;
66
import net.sf.json.JSONObject;
7-
import org.kohsuke.stapler.StaplerRequest;
7+
import org.kohsuke.stapler.StaplerRequest2;
88

99
@Deprecated
1010
public class DockerPluginConfiguration extends GlobalConfiguration {
@@ -28,7 +28,7 @@ public DockerPluginConfiguration() {
2828
}
2929

3030
@Override
31-
public boolean configure(StaplerRequest req, JSONObject json) throws FormException {
31+
public boolean configure(StaplerRequest2 req, JSONObject json) throws FormException {
3232
req.bindJSON(this, json);
3333
return true;
3434
}

src/test/java/io/jenkins/docker/connector/DockerComputerConnectorTest.java

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-56,15 +56,15 @@ protected static String getJenkinsDockerImageVersionForThisEnvironment() {
5656
*/
5757
final int javaVersion = getJavaVersion();
5858
if (SystemUtils.IS_OS_WINDOWS) {
59-
if (javaVersion >= 11) {
60-
return "jdk11-nanoserver-1809";
59+
if (javaVersion >= 21) {
60+
return "jdk21-nanoserver-1809";
6161
}
62-
return "jdk8-nanoserver-1809";
62+
return "jdk17-nanoserver-1809";
6363
}
64-
if (javaVersion >= 11) {
65-
return "latest-jdk11";
64+
if (javaVersion >= 21) {
65+
return "latest-jdk21";
6666
}
67-
return "latest-jdk8";
67+
return "latest-jdk17";
6868
}
6969

7070
protected String getLabelForTemplate() {

src/test/java/io/jenkins/docker/pipeline/DockerNodeStepTest.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-384,7 +384,7 @@ public void defaults() {
384384
Collections.emptyList()));
385385
WorkflowJob j = r.createProject(WorkflowJob.class, "p");
386386
j.setDefinition(new CpsFlowDefinition(
387-
dockerNodeWithImage("openjdk:11") + " {\n"
387+
dockerNodeWithImage("eclipse-temurin:17-jre") + " {\n"
388388
+ " sh 'java -version && whoami && pwd && touch stuff && ls -lat . ..'\n"
389389
+ "}\n",
390390
true));

0 commit comments

Comments
 (0)